Apple Inc. $AAPL Shares Purchased by Warner Group LLC

Warner Group LLC increased its stake in Apple Inc. (NASDAQ:AAPLFree Report) by 80.6% in the fourth quarter, according to the company in its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The firm owned 24,986 shares of the iPhone maker’s stock after purchasing an additional 11,152 shares during the period. Apple makes up 4.2% of Warner Group LLC’s holdings, making the stock its 8th largest position. Warner Group LLC’s holdings in Apple were worth $6,793,000 as of its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ission.

Apple Price Performance

Shares of AAPL opened at $307.34 on Friday. Apple Inc. has a 1 year low of $195.07 and a 1 year high of $316.94.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.70, a current ratio of 1.07 and a quick ratio of 1.02. The company has a market capitalization of $4.51 trillion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 37.16, a price-to-earnings-growth ratio of 2.71 and a beta of 1.09. The business has a 50-day moving average of $281.39 and a 200-day moving average of $271.37.

Apple (NASDAQ:AAPLGet Free Report) last issued its earnings results on Thursday, April 30th. The iPhone maker reported $2.01 earnings per share for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$1.95 by $0.06. The business had revenue of $111.18 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$109.46 billion. Apple had a return on equity of 146.69% and a net margin of 27.15%.The firm’s revenue for the quarter was up 16.6% on a year-over-year basis. During the same period in the previous year, the company posted $1.65 earnings per share. As a group, equities research analysts anticipate that Apple Inc. will post 8.74 earnings per share for the current year.

Apple Increases Dividend

The firm also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Thursday, May 14th. Shareholders of record on Monday, May 11th were issued a $0.27 dividend. The ex-dividend date was Monday, May 11th. This is an increase from Apple’s previous quarterly dividend of $0.26. This represents a $1.08 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 0.4%. Apple’s dividend payout ratio is presently 13.06%.

Apple Inc (NASDAQ: AAPL) is a multinational technology company headquartered in Cupertino, California, founded in 1976 by Steve Jobs, Steve Wozniak and Ronald Wayne. The company designs, develops and sells consumer electronics, software and services. Over its history Apple has evolved from personal computers to a broad portfolio that spans mobile devices, wearables, home entertainment and digital services.

Apple’s principal hardware products include the iPhone smartphone, iPad tablet, Mac personal computers, Apple Watch wearable devices and a range of accessories such as AirPods and HomePod.
